Fabled Game Studio is thrilled to announce Pirates Outlaws 2: Heritage, the highly anticipated sequel to their 2019 hit, Pirates Outlaws. This roguelike deck-builder returns with all the features players loved, plus exciting new additions. A full release is slated for 2025 on Android, iOS, PC (via Steam and Epic Games).
Fabled Game is hosting an open beta test on Steam from October 25th to 31st. Mobile players will need to wait a little longer for their chance to join the adventure.
What's New in Pirates Outlaws 2?
Pirates Outlaws 2 introduces a new hero with a backstory set years after the original game. This hero starts with pre-built decks and unique ability cards, setting the stage for a fresh and exciting experience. But the enhancements don't stop there!
Prepare to meet your companions, who will add their own unique cards to your arsenal. A brand-new fusion mechanic lets you combine three identical cards to create something even more powerful. Level up your deck strategically using the evolution tree, unlocking new possibilities. Even previously discarded cards now hold upgrade potential. Relic acquisition has been revamped; instead of finding them after every fight, you'll discover them in markets, after boss battles, or during special events.
Battles now feature a dynamic Countdown system, influencing enemy actions. The "End Turn" button is replaced with "ReDraw," adding a new layer of strategic depth. A new armor and shield system further enhances the gameplay experience.

While boasting new mechanics, Pirates Outlaws 2 retains the core gameplay that made the original a success. You'll still be crafting decks, navigating treacherous seas, and battling your way through Arena and Campaign modes. Classic features like ammo management, melee-ranged-skill card combos, curses, and diverse enemy races all return. For more in-depth information, visit the official website.
